Local tips

  • Arrive early to secure a good spot on the beach, especially during weekends and holidays.
  • Bring your own food and drinks, as there are limited facilities nearby.
  • Wear sunscreen and a hat, as shade can be limited on sunny days.
  • Check the tide times before visiting to enjoy the best swimming conditions.
  • Don't forget to explore the nearby walking trails for breathtaking views and encounters with local wildlife.

Wattamolla Beach, located within the magnificent Royal National Park in New South Wales, is a true coastal paradise that attracts tourists seeking both relaxation and adventure. The beach is characterized by its soft golden sands and crystal-clear waters, making it an ideal spot for swimming and sunbathing. The surrounding scenery is equally stunning, with lush green bushland that provides a serene backdrop for visitors. As you stroll along the beach, you can take in the breathtaking views of the coastline, where the ocean meets the rugged cliffs of the park. For nature enthusiasts, Wattamolla Beach is surrounded by a variety of walking trails that lead to hidden coves and scenic lookouts. The area is rich in biodiversity, offering opportunities for birdwatching and spotting local wildlife. Families will appreciate the picnic areas equipped with tables and barbecues, perfect for a leisurely lunch enjoyed with the sound of waves crashing in the background. The calm lagoon at Wattamolla also provides a safe swimming environment for children, making it a popular choice for families. Visiting Wattamolla Beach is not just about sun and surf; it's also a place to connect with nature and appreciate the beauty of the Australian landscape. With its combination of sandy shores, tranquil waters, and lush surroundings, Wattamolla Beach is a must-visit destination for anyone exploring New South Wales.
